Pros and cons of a Delaware C-Corp

You’ve finally formed your entity (LLC, S-Corp or other non-DE C-Corp entity)—congratulations! But as you build your business in hopes to become venture-backed the mention of being a DE C-Corp has now probably come up a number of times. So why flip?

While there are specific reasons and benefits to building a business as an LLC, S-Corp, or non-DE C-Corp, the benefits of being a Delaware C-Corp tend to outweigh those of others if you plan to scale in the venture-backed ecosystem. In this webinar, Atrium Counsel, Jason Kornfeld will dive into topics such as:

  • Why many companies decide to flip
  • What to consider when making this decision
  • What the process of flipping looks like